Before the incident
Drawing a patient lab work.
What happened
I was putting the butterfly needle in the sharp 's container it did not go all the way so I pushed it down not realizing when I pushed the needle after sticking the patient it did not slide all the way up the prevent the needle from showing. The needle snagged my glove. I took the glove off and notice it punctured my skin. It wasn 't deep but it 's something I needed to report.
